基于USB接口和DSP的飞机防滑刹车测试系统

发布者:代码漫游者最新更新时间:2007-04-20 来源: 电子技术应用关键字:控制  高速  数据  采集 手机看文章 扫描二维码
随时随地手机看文章

飞机防滑刹车控制器作为飞机防滑刹车系统的核心部件,其设计好坏直接影响到飞机的安全起飞和安全着陆刹车,系统性能的好坏需要通过测试设备来检验。我国对控制器的研究已有半个多世纪的时间,从机械-气压式到目前的数字式,均取得了良好的效果。而对控制盒测试的研究却处于一片空白,迄今为止仍用人工仪器对控制盒进行性能测试,不仅操作复杂,而且耗用大量的空间和时间。本文设计的刹车测试系统可以弥补此项空白。

微机技术的发展、单片机的广泛应用以及便携式电脑的出现,为测试系统的发展提供了良好的硬件平台,高速化、便携式、微型化、低成本、智能化成为测试系统的最大特点。通用串行总线(USB)以其即插即用、速度快、低成本等特点而倍受青睐,逐步取代了传统的RS232通信,广泛应用于各种测试系统中。其中,USB接口的设计方案很多,主要有两种类型:一种是采用MCU和USB接口芯片分离式结构,此类方案的特点是成本和开发难度较低。另一种方案是采用嵌入式结构,即采用带USB接口的MCU或内嵌MCU的USB接口芯片,此类方案的特点是成本高、不适用于简单和低成本的数据采集测试系统。这里采用了第一种方案,实用并且开发周期较短。

1 数字式飞机防滑刹车测试系统的组成

数字式飞机防滑刹车测试系统的组成如图1所示。图中虚线框内为飞机防滑刹车测试系统的原理框图,测试系统需要向防滑刹车控制器提供模拟机轮速度信号、模拟踏板信号、各种开关信号和各种故障状态,以便模拟实际的刹车状态。测试系统采集控制器输出的阀门电压和参考速度信号,通过USB芯片传输给上位机,由上位机来显示,依此判断控制器的工作状态。

2 主要硬件电路的设计

2.1 前端信号调理电路

前端信号调理电路如图2所示。参考速度信号、阀门电压信号、模拟踏板信号均为直流信号,范围为0~10V,由于DSP的A/D端只能接收0~5V的电平,因此需要进行电平转换。先将输入信号进行跟随,提高输入阻抗,再进行两级反相比例放大。将0~10V的输入电压转换为0~5V的输出电压,末端的两个二极管起限幅作用。

2.2 模拟机轮速度信号电路

在实际的刹车过程中,机轮速度传感器产生的信号为近似正弦信号,所以利用正弦信号代替机轮速度信号。信号发生电路原理框图如图3所示。AD9850输出的信号经过I/V转换电路转换为电压输出,输出电压经过有效值/直流转换电路输出交流信号的平均值,该值和I/V转换输出的信号做减法运算,得到以0电平为基准的交流信号。再与直流偏置做加法运算,得到一个带直流偏置的正弦信号。经过二阶压控低通滤波后输出峰峰值为0.6~5V可调、直流偏置0~5V可调的正弦信号,此信号可作为机轮速度模拟信号。

AD9850为美国ADI公司推出的一款DDS集成芯片,8位并行数据接口D0~D7或者一位串行数据接口D7,在写时钟端W_CLK和频率升降控制端FR_UD的控制下,可直接输入频率、相位等控制数据,最大工作时钟为125MHz,最小工作时钟为1MHz。内有32位累加器、sin/cos表,集成10位D/A电流型输出,采用28脚贴片封装。

AD9850接口电路如图4所示,D0~D7口与DSP的数据线D0~D7相连。复位引脚与DSP的PC0口相接,高电平复位,复位时间不低于40ms。FR_UD引脚与DSP的PC1脚相接。WCLK1是地址线经过可编程逻辑器件GAL16V8或逻辑后产生的片选信号。Rset连接3.9kΩ的电阻,设定最大的输出电流为10mA。IOUTB端连接24Ω的电阻,作为电流输出补偿电阻。

2.3 USB通信电路设计

CH375为国内自主研发的新型USB接口芯片。它支持3.3V和5V供电,支持全速USB设备接口,兼容US-BV2.0;提供一对主端点和一对辅助端点,支持控制传输、批量传输、中断传输;具有省事的内置固件模式和灵 活的外部固件模式。内置固件模式下屏蔽了相关的USB协议,自动完成标准的USB枚举配置过程,完全不需要本地端控制器做任何处理,简化了单片机的固件编程;通用的8位并行数据总线控制简单,采用4线控制:读选通、写选通、片选输入、中断输出;通用Windows驱动程序提供设备级接口;体积小,采用SSOP-28封装。

与DSP的接口连接如图5所示。CH375的8位并行接口直接与DSP的数据线低8位相连。/WR和/RD分别与DSP的WR和RD信号相连,DSP的地址线A0与CH375的A0端口相连,作为CH375的命令和数据端口的选择,片选信号是经过可编程逻辑器件GAL16V8进行与逻辑后产生的片选信号。电容C4用于CH375内部电源节点退耦,可选用1000pF~0.01μF的独石或者高频磁片电容。电容C3和C5构成外部电源退耦。晶体Y1、电容C1和C2构成CH375的时钟振荡电路,Y1选用12MHz晶振,Cl和C2选用15pF~30pF的独石或高频磁片电容。中断端口与DSP的外部中断1相接,下降沿有效。

3 测试系统的软件设计

测试系统的软件设计包括下位机程序设计和上位机用户平台的开发。

3.1 下位机软件的设计

下位机程序包括系统初始化、A/D数据采集子程序、正弦信号发生子程序和USB中断服务子程序。系统初始化包括DSP寄存器的初始化、AD9850初始化和CH375的初始化。AD9850初始化包括复位AD9850和控制字初始化,先让PC0口输出高电平,延时40ms后,输出低电平,完成AD9850复位;将控制字0x00写入AD9850,定义为并行输入,初始相位为0,电源休眠控制。CH375的初始化先对CH375自检,判断CH375是否工作正常,如果工作正常则进入下一步,否则继续等待;将CH375配置为内置固件模式。A/D数据采集完成16路模拟量的采集,采用中值法数字滤波技术对数据进行处理。正弦信号发生子程序先计算输出频率的频率控制字,向AD9850中写入控制字,再将频率控制字从低字节到高字节分4次通过数据线写入AD9850中。USB数据发送过程为:先向CH375写入WR_USB_DATA命令,等待USB主机取走数据,然后CH375锁定当前的缓冲区,防止重复发送数据,将INT#引脚设置为低,进入USB中断服务子程序,执行GET_STATUS命令获取中断状态,执行WR_USB_DATA命令,写入待发送数据。执行UNLOCK_USB命令释放缓冲区,退出中断服务子程序,等待发送下一组数据。

3.2 上位机用户平台的设计

采用VC++6.0作为上位机开发工具,实现数据显示、保存、分析等功能。上位机用户平台具有以下特点:①通过波形、数值、指示灯等方式实时显示数据和系统特性;②光标读取数据参数,系统可以利用光标读取任意时刻的参数;③方便的标记功能,可以在任意两点之间进行标记,计算对应波形图的值;④对于历史数据可以通过文件形式保存下来。上位机流程图如图6所示。

USB为计算机外设提供了一个全新的接口标准。它不占用IRQ和DMA资源,具有热插拔、即插即用、自动配置的能力。在本测试系统中,采用USB1.1协议设计与计算机通讯,与笔记本电脑相结合可以构成移动式的飞机防滑刹车测试仪,可以方便地使用于机场、野外等传统人工测试设备不便使用的场合。

关键字:控制  高速  数据  采集 引用地址:基于USB接口和DSP的飞机防滑刹车测试系统

上一篇:MSO4000:业内领先的混合信号示波器
下一篇:单相电能计量芯片MCP3906及其应用

推荐阅读最新更新时间:2024-05-13 18:35

Azoteq 触摸控制产品现通过 Digi-Key 向全球现货发售
Azoteq 与全球电子元器件分销商 Digi-Key Electronics 签署了新的代理协议,现通过 Digi-Key 向全球客户提供触摸感应产品组合。 设计人员可使用 Azoteq 产品为设计添加触摸控制功能。从简单触摸到完整的触控板,均可帮助工程师提升所设计产品的用户体验。 Azoteq 市场营销部副总裁 Jean Viljoen 表示,“为了因应物联网时代的到来,Azoteq 推出了独特的 ProxFusion™ 传感器解决方案,而我们的最佳合作伙伴 Digi-Key 可确保开发工程师们隔天即可拿到我们的样品、评估套件和工具。在与 Digi-Key 达成合作后,Azoteq 进一步扩展了全球业务覆盖范围,确保为全球提供
[物联网]
逆变器的温度调节控制与散热装置影响发电量
  越趋成熟的光伏市场,需要的是更复杂的产品组合,而不是一体适用(One sizes fits all)。大陆531新政出台后,将爆发式成长的太阳能市场带往缓慢稳定成长的方向。随之而来的是产业洗牌与朝向健康化发展,能够站稳这波洪流的厂商,除了要具备前瞻性思维外,更重要的是具有完善的产品组合与数字能源解决方案才能生存下来。         综观2018年组件呈现多元化的发展,多重的技术与混搭迭加,为的就是能够增益效率,例如双玻双面混搭半切电池片,就是为了能在既定的面积下增加最大的发电效益,模块的电压从最早的600V到现在已经往1500V迈进,通过提升直流侧电压,可以减少线损和电力设备的数量,进而降低初始投资成本(CapEx)和提高
[新能源]
单片机控制继电器 使LED灯交替闪烁
今天看到了继电器,想用89C51单片机控制它,使其能控制更丰富的电路,以完成一些复杂的功能。 首先用单片机的P2^0直接加到继电器上,发现没有反应,于是查了相关资料。发现单片机引脚输出的电流太小,不足以驱动继电器。 解决方法:利用三极管工作在饱和区的特性(开关特性)使继电器直接加在5伏电源之间,使其工作(或者说可以有足够的电流驱动它)。 注意:这里三极管并不是起放大电流的作用,只是当作一个开关。 原理图如图一(手画有点丑,见谅)。 连接电路前先不要接二极管D1,一会再解释二极管的作用。三极管是2n3904 NPN型三极管,基极电阻68欧姆,要把图中的5v电源vcc1和gnd1分别接到单片机的电源和地上., LED灯的电路由外
[单片机]
高效、可靠和紧凑的eFuse优化服务器和数据中心电源设计
在设计服务器和数据中心电源时,设计人员除了需要考虑提升能效和功率密度,还要确保尽可能高的安全性和可靠性,这带来一系列挑战,如无安全工作区(SOA)的顾虑、和诊断及响应等功能安全等等。安森美半导体提供高效、可靠和紧凑的eFuse方案阵容,包括3 V至12 V电源范围和即将推出的24 V、48 V eFuse,帮助设计人员解决这些挑战。这些eFuse内置实时诊断功能、精密控制和多重保护特性,响应快,性能和可靠性优于竞争对手。 eFuse简介、特性及目标应用 eFuse集成过流、过热及过压保护,提供电流检测、故障报告、输出开关控制、反向电流保护、对地短路保护、电池短路保护、可复位,用于任何热插拔应用和需要限制过冲电流的系统,以
[电源管理]
高效、可靠和紧凑的eFuse优化服务器和<font color='red'>数据</font>中心电源设计
高速数字化仪和AWG在车辆总线(CAN/LIN/PSI5)测试中的应用(一)
引言 模块化仪器比传统仪器的尺寸大大减小,适合安装在电路卡上,同时也可以将多个卡插入具有通用计算机 接口 、 电源 和互连的框架中。模块化仪器框架包括使用标准PCIe接口的计算机、PXI测试框架或基于LXI的盒子, 工程师 通常会使用多个卡并将其配置到测试系统中,系统可能包含多个仪器、具有多个通道的单一仪器类型或两者的组合。 上图显示了配备两个PCIe模块化数字化仪的便携式计算机。这种紧凑、独立的装置可在车辆内使用,允许车辆行驶时进行测量。基于PXI的模块化系统并不具有自主性,他们需要外部显示器和键盘才能工作,但可以在单个机箱内按需配置更多数量的模块化仪器。基于LXI的系统(例如德思特数字化仪和AWG二合一 产品 )非常适
[汽车电子]
基于PCS7 和Profibus-DP 现场总线技术的控制系统设计
   一 系统概述   随着经济高速发展,城市化步伐速度也日益加快,城市生活垃圾和工业垃圾处理问题正变得 日益突出。每年全国城市垃圾清运量达数亿吨,在各大城市中,垃圾包围城市的现象非常普遍。垃圾已对大气环境及地表和地下水及江河、湖泊等造成了严重污染,生态环境正在遭到严重破坏。因此,结合城市具体情况,对垃圾的处理技术和处理系统及其控制策略等相关问题进行探讨,找出处理效果好、经济上可行的处理方案已成为目前城市垃圾处理问题研究的热点之一。   焚烧处理垃圾的主要优点是垃圾减量最大,无害化比较彻底。如焚烧垃圾发电是现有垃圾处理方法中占地较小,效果较好的方法。另外,建立垃圾焚烧发电厂,可解决垃圾渗沥液引起的污染地下水问题,垃圾焚烧后的废渣进
[嵌入式]
自主研发SCARA问世 勃肯特跻身高速度解决方案提供商
随着人口红利的逐渐褪去和“机器换人”政策的大力推行,更具速度优势与高性价比的工业机器人获得越来越多制造业企业的青睐。其中SCARA机器人以其高速、高精度、高性价比的特点倍受市场欢迎。然而目前国内企业使用的高性能SCARA机器人产品仍以进口品牌为主,但相应也面临着价格高昂和服务滞后等问题。作为工业机器人本体研发企业,勃肯特始终将客户需求放在首位,结合市场需求着手研发设计,继并联本体全系列及BeMotion控制系统后,又重磅推出了新款SCARA机器人BKT-AS-400。该产品的问世旨在打破进口品牌对高端SCARA机器人的技术封锁,通过高性价比和快速响应的优质服务打开国内市场,并且配合原有并联系列提升整体解决方案的能力,打造整套企业自
[机器人]
Arm CEO表示Arm比其他架构更适合数据中心的省电需求
Arm CEO Rene Haas日前表示,当前人工智能 (AI) 的爆炸式增长,特别是生成式人工智能 (gen AI) 的训练和操作,存在“无法满足的能源需求”,但他表示,Arm处于独特的地位,可以提供帮助,并指出最新的 Neoverse CPU IP 可以提供比竞争对手更好的能效。 “人工智能有潜力超越上个世纪创造的所有变革性创新。在医疗保健、生产力、教育和许多其他领域给社会带来的好处将超出我们的想象。”Haas声称。“为了运行这些复杂的人工智能工作负载,全球数据中心所需的计算量需要呈指数级增长。然而,这种对计算的永不满足的需求暴露了一个严峻的挑战:数据中心需要巨大的电力来推动这项突破性的技术。” Haas 表示,如今
[网络通信]
小广播
502 Bad Gateway

502 Bad Gateway


openresty
502 Bad Gateway

502 Bad Gateway


openresty
502 Bad Gateway

502 Bad Gateway


openresty
502 Bad Gateway

502 Bad Gateway


openresty
502 Bad Gateway

502 Bad Gateway


openresty
随便看看
    502 Bad Gateway

    502 Bad Gateway


    openresty

About Us 关于我们 客户服务 联系方式 器件索引 网站地图 最新更新 手机版

站点相关: 安防电子 医疗电子 工业控制

词云: 1 2 3 4 5 6 7 8 9 10

北京市海淀区中关村大街18号B座15层1530室 电话:(010)82350740 邮编:100190

电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号 Copyright © 2005-2024 EEWORLD.com.cn, Inc. All rights reserved
502 Bad Gateway

502 Bad Gateway


openresty